Unprecedental clarity has come to our understanding of genetic differences by the analysis of DNA sequences. It is not surprising in which the latest DNA technologies are leading to a resurgence of interest in population genetics. In this evaluation, we discuss present progress and future directions by reconstructing the history of human populations. There is raising consensus on a recent Out of Africa origin of modern humans that explain why the greatest fraction of genetic diversity is found within populations, rather than between them. The comparison of Y mitochondrial and chromosome DNA data represents remarkable sex variations in geographic difference. The analysis of Neanderthal DNA has been a main get through in the learning of fossil DNA. Among main hopes for the future is application to polygenic diseases.
